BANDAR SERI BEGAWAN, May possibly 10 (Borneo Bulletin/ANN): The Brunei Ministry of Wellness (MoH) has issued an advisory from employing Lianhua Qingwen and Lianhua Qingwen Jiaonang products for cure or prevention of Covid-19, adding that promises for the herbal treatment to handle the virus are unsubstantiated.
It said Lianhua Qingwen or Lianhua Qingwen Jiaonang products and solutions have ephedra, an organic plant with constituent of active alkaloids these kinds of as ephedrine and pseudoephedrine.
The ministry claimed the continuous use of ephedrine with out supervision could trigger facet effects this kind of as nervousness, headache, insomnia, nausea, higher blood strain, irregular heartbeat and heart assault.
The MoH stated in watch of its basic safety worry and adverse effects, the community is suggested from its use and/or constant use without the need of trying to find prior suggestions from a registered health-related practitioner.
The ministry explained even though a drugs regulatory authority from a neighbouring region has shown some Lianhua Qingwen products and solutions as Chinese traditional drugs with accredited use for the reduction of cold and flu signs or symptoms, the merchandise are not indicated for the prevention or remedy of Covid-19.
The MoH mentioned it calls for any solution claimed to be in a position to address Covid-19 to deliver ample scientific proof from scientific trials to show its security and efficacy.
Complete documents ought to also be submitted to the ministry for analysis before it can be authorised and imported into the region, claimed MoH, introducing that the ministry has not issued any acceptance for organic merchandise together with Lianhua Qingwen for use in the avoidance and remedy of Covid-19.
The ministry advised the public to be vigilant and not to fall prey to herbal or dietary supplement products with unfounded promises.
The ministry also warns suppliers and suppliers (including on the net retailers on social media) that it is an offence to boost any products with phony or deceptive statements of stopping or dealing with diseases.
The penalty on conviction is a high-quality not exceeding BND5,000, imprisonment for a term not exceeding two years or both equally. – Borneo Bulletin/ANN
